Skip to main content
CheckTown
Validadores

Validación de códigos BIC/SWIFT: Todo lo que necesitas saber

Publicado 5 min de lectura
En este artículo

¿Qué es un código BIC/SWIFT?

Un BIC (Bank Identifier Code), también conocido como código SWIFT, es un código de 8 u 11 caracteres que identifica de forma única a una institución financiera en las transacciones internacionales. BIC significa Business Identifier Code y es el estándar ISO 9362 utilizado en más de 200 países.

La estructura es: código de institución de 4 letras + código de país de 2 letras + código de ubicación de 2 caracteres + código de sucursal opcional de 3 caracteres. Por ejemplo, DEUTDEDB es el código principal de Deutsche Bank para Alemania.

Cómo funciona la validación BIC

La validación BIC comprueba la integridad estructural del código según la especificación ISO 9362.

  • Comprobación de longitud — debe tener exactamente 8 u 11 caracteres
  • Código de institución — los primeros 4 caracteres deben ser únicamente letras
  • Código de país — los caracteres 5-6 deben ser un código de país ISO 3166-1 alpha-2 válido

Pruébalo gratis — sin registro

Validar un código BIC/SWIFT →

Cuándo usar la validación BIC

La validación BIC es fundamental en cualquier flujo de trabajo de pagos internacionales donde los códigos de enrutamiento incorrectos provoquen transferencias fallidas o mal dirigidas.

  • Formularios de transferencia bancaria — valida el BIC junto al IBAN para garantizar un enrutamiento de pago completo y correcto
  • Importación de datos financieros — depura los datos de referencia bancaria al importar desde sistemas heredados
  • Integraciones de API — valida antes de llamar a las API de pasarelas de pago para evitar errores de rechazo

Preguntas frecuentes

¿Cuál es la diferencia entre BIC y código SWIFT?

Son lo mismo. SWIFT (Society for Worldwide Interbank Financial Telecommunication) gestiona el registro BIC. Ambos términos se usan indistintamente en la práctica.

¿Cuándo se usa el BIC de 11 caracteres frente al de 8 caracteres?

El código de 8 caracteres identifica la institución y su oficina principal. La versión de 11 caracteres añade un código de sucursal. Para envíos a la sede central, puedes usar el código de 8 caracteres o añadir XXX para obtener el equivalente de 11 caracteres.

¿Puedo validar si un código BIC está activo actualmente?

La validación del formato confirma que el código sigue las reglas ISO 9362. Para verificar si un BIC está registrado y activo en la red SWIFT, necesitarías acceso al directorio BIC de SWIFT, que es un servicio de pago.

Herramientas relacionadas